# Perl Cheat Sheet ## Basics ### Comments ```perl # This is a comment ``` ### Print ```perl print "Hello, World!\n"; ``` ### Variables ```perl $scalar_variable = 42; @array_variable = (1, 2, 3); %hash_variable = ('key' => 'value'); ``` ## Control Structures ### if-else ```perl if ($condition) { # Code to execute if condition is true } else { # Code to execute if condition is false } ``` ### foreach ```perl foreach $item (@array) { # Code to execute for each item in the array } ``` ### while ```perl while ($condition) { # Code to execute while condition is true } ``` ## Subroutines ```perl sub greet { my $name = shift; print "Hello, $name!\n"; } greet("Alice"); ``` ## Regular Expressions ### Matching ```perl if ($string =~ /pattern/) { # Code to execute if pattern is found in $string } ``` ### Substitution ```perl $string =~ s/find/replace/; ``` ## File Handling ### Open and Read ```perl open(my $file, '<', 'filename.txt') or die "Can't open file: $!"; while (<$file>) { chomp; print "$_\n"; } close($file); ``` ### Open and Write ```perl open(my $file, '>', 'output.txt') or die "Can't open file: $!"; print $file "Hello, File!\n"; close($file); ``` ## Modules ### Using Modules ```perl use Module::Name; ``` ### Exporting Functions ```perl use Module::Name qw(function1 function2); ``` ## References ### Scalar Reference ```perl $scalar_ref = \$scalar_variable; ``` ### Array Reference ```perl $array_ref = \@array_variable; ``` ### Hash Reference ```perl $hash_ref = \%hash_variable; ``` # Advanced Perl Cheat Sheet ## Basics ### Comments ```perl # This is a comment ``` ### Print ```perl print "Hello, World!\n"; ``` ### Variables ```perl $scalar_variable = 42; @array_variable = (1, 2, 3); %hash_variable = ('key' => 'value'); ``` ### Data Types ```perl $string = "Perl"; $number = 42; $float = 3.14; ``` ## Control Structures ### if-else ```perl if ($condition) { # Code to execute if condition is true } elsif ($another_condition) { # Code to execute if another condition is true } else { # Code to execute if all conditions are false } ``` ### foreach ```perl foreach $item (@array) { # Code to execute for each item in the array } ``` ### while ```perl while ($condition) { # Code to execute while condition is true } ``` ## Subroutines ```perl sub greet { my $name = shift; print "Hello, $name!\n"; } greet("Alice"); ``` ### Returning Values ```perl sub add { my ($num1, $num2) = @_; return $num1 + $num2; } my $result = add(3, 4); print "Sum: $result\n"; ``` ## Regular Expressions ### Matching ```perl if ($string =~ /pattern/) { # Code to execute if pattern is found in $string } ``` ### Substitution ```perl $string =~ s/find/replace/; ``` ## File Handling ### Open and Read ```perl open(my $file, '<', 'filename.txt') or die "Can't open file: $!"; while (<$file>) { chomp; print "$_\n"; } close($file); ``` ### Open and Write ```perl open(my $file, '>', 'output.txt') or die "Can't open file: $!"; print $file "Hello, File!\n"; close($file); ``` ## Modules ### Using Modules ```perl use Module::Name; ``` ### Exporting Functions ```perl use Module::Name qw(function1 function2); ``` ## References ### Scalar Reference ```perl $scalar_ref = \$scalar_variable; ``` ### Array Reference ```perl $array_ref = \@array_variable; ``` ### Hash Reference ```perl $hash_ref = \%hash_variable; ``` ## Structuring a Perl Script for Bash ### Create a Perl Script ```perl #!/usr/bin/perl use strict; use warnings; # Perl script code here print "Hello from Perl!\n"; ``` ### Make it Executable ```bash chmod +x script.pl ``` ### Run from Bash ```bash ./script.pl ```
